and at the risk of dragging this back on-topic...

as well as england, ol' georgey boy is also patron saint of aragon, agricultural workers, archers, armourers, beirut, lebanon, boy scouts, butchers, canada, cappadocia, catalonia, cavalry, chivalry, constantinople, crusaders, equestrians, farmers, ferrara italy, field hands, field workers, genoa, georgia, germany, gozo, greece, herpes, horsemen, horses, husbandmen, istanbul, knights, lepers, leprosy, lithuania, malta, moscow, order of the garter, palestine, palestinian christians, plague, portugal, riders, saddle makers, saddlers, skin diseases, skin rashes, soldiers, syphilis, teutonic knights and venice.

so, something for just about everybody.

According to Fortean Times:
23 April. St George's Day. 'Green George' was the spirit of spring, and his image was common in old church carvings, a human head surrounded by leaves or looking out of a tree trunk. Some called him the witches' god. George the dragon killer evolved from a mixture of Green George, the Northern hero Sigurd (Siegfied) the dragon-slayer and an Arian bishop of Alexandria who put to death an orthodox Master of the Mint called Dracontius (dragon). St George was adopted as the patron saint of England in 1349 when Edward III founded the Order of the Garter.
